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
984972447 49787369 1692668126 4273010
199144 83525724 82
199144 83525724 82
6659960596 51706275 84 917
All about undefined
Interested in learning more?
199144 83525724 82
6659960596 51706275 84 917
See more
8501 82 6953418731
7408824 858754 90915015
See more
544619 41698057 3771990
5823 3725 00658
See more